Aug. 24--'The Nanny Diaries' --
Horrible, horrible women are everywhere, just waiting for other women -- lucky, lucky women -- to exact revenge on their former employers by writing modern urban fairy tales about them. (Men do it, too, of course.) Sometimes these Manhattan-set acts of wish fulfillment are wished right onto the screen, as was the case with "The Devil Wears Prada," one of the nicest schlock-elevating improvements from page to film since "The Bridges of Madison County."
Now, very much in the "Prada" vein, we have "The Nanny Diaries." Like last summer's hit it boasts a blue-chip cast, including Scarlett Johansson as the reluctant, much-abused…
